Management and 
Monitoring
Understanding the management and monitoring tools available in 3WXM 
can help you to quickly identify and correct problems in your wireless 
network, as well as to provide you with the statistics and reporting 
information you need to optimize your network.
This section discusses the following management and monitoring 
features:
„
Network Status
„
RF monitoring
„
Client monitoring
„
Rogue detection
„
Event logging
„
Verification 
„
Reporting
Network Status
3WXM provides summary status on devices in the network at the mobility 
domain, switch or MAP level. View the summary status as the initial step 
in monitoring. Summary status displays the operational status of WX 
switches, MAP access points, and their radios (whether they are up or 
down).
In addition, 3WXM collects network statistics for devices, including 
system-level events and statistics for the wired network. 
The Alerts panel in the bottom, left panel in 3WXM displays top-level 
status information. The Alerts panel provides you with summary error and 
warning information for the following areas:
„
Configuration—indicates network plan configuration issues
„
Network—indicates managed network issues
„
Rogue detection—identifies the number of rogue APs detected
„
Local changes—indicates changes in 3WXM that can be deployed to 
the network
„
Network changes—indicates configuration changes in the network
